2. Destruction and black holes: The innovative 'storage fund' model

The most ingenious design of Walrus's economic model is that it constructs a 'black hole' that absorbs circulating supply—the storage fund.
1. Payment equals lock-up
In the Walrus protocol, when users pay for storage fees, this WAL is not directly given to node miners to sell off. Instead, this money first enters a public 'storage fund pool'.
It's like you paid a year's rent, but this money is frozen in a regulatory account.
For the market, this part of WAL instantly disappears from the circulating supply (it is locked). This leads to a contraction in circulation.
2. Gradual release of funds
Node miners can only gradually receive their wages from the fund pool over time, after proving that they have indeed stored the data.
The key point is: users store data with a 'one-time large payment' (instant lock-up), while miners sell coins with 'linear slow release'. This time difference of 'fast inflow and slow outflow' creates a natural upward buffer zone for WAL's price.
